What are the spec differences between the "Motorola Edge+ (2020) 256GB" and "BLU Bold N1 (2019) 128GB" ?
A summary of the technical specifications of the "Motorola Edge+ (2020) 256GB" and "BLU Bold N1 (2019) 128GB". Functions and performance variations on the same model will be highlighted in red.
Motorola Edge+ (2020) 256GB | BLU Bold N1 (2019) 128GB | |
Color | Smokey Sangria/Thunder Grey | Raven Black |
OS | Android | Android |
Dimensions (width x height x thickness) | 71.4mm x 161.1mm x 9.6mm | 74.1mm x 158.7mm x 8.6mm |
Weight | 203.0g | 182.0g |
Display size | 6.7inch | 6.4inch |
Display type | AMOLED | AMOLED |
Screen resolution (width x height) | 1080 x 2340 | 1080 x 2340 |
Pixel density | 384ppi | 402ppi |
Battery capacity | 5000.0mAh | 3500.0mAh |
Chipset | Qualcomm SM8250 Snapdragon 865 | Mediatek MT6771V Helio P70 |
CPU specs | 2.84GHz+2.42GHz+1.8GHz×8(8.0-cores) | 2.1GHz+2.1GHz×8(8.0-cores) |
RAM size | 12.0GB | 4.0GB |
Storage size | 256.0GB | 128.0GB |
Rear-camera resolution | 108.0MP | 16.0MP |
Front-camera resolution | 25.0MP | 13.0MP |
